Shika-no-tsunokiri (Deer-Antler-Cutting Ceremony)

鹿の角きり

 

 

Deer antlers are removed with a saw as part of this traditional event that has continued for over 300 years.

EVENT/OPEN PERIOD 3 days in mid-Oct.
HOURS 12:00pm-3:00pm (entrance until 2:30pm)
COST Adults 1000 yen | Elementary School Students and younger 300 yen/
ADDRESS Rokuen Tsunokiri, 160 Kasuganocho, Nara-shi
ACCESS 7 min. walk from Kasuga Taisha Omotesando bus stop. 10 min. ride on Nara Kotsu City Loop Bus Sotomawari (outer loop) from Kintetsu Nara Station on Kintetsu Nara Line.
TEL 0742-22-2388
OTHER CONTACT INFO Naranoshika Aigokai Foundation
WEBSITE http://www.naradeer.com/
CREDIT CARD Not accepted
